The Art of Preaching (1)

Pacing your Preaching.
Preaching is an art and a skill. It is inspirational as wells educational. eventful as well as poetic.
Timing is important. It may not matter news you're on radio or TV. The allocated time allows you to say the essential things and leave the rest for the next show. It allows you to say what is necessary which in turn makes a message more memorable and specific. Too much content can confuse the listener as can too many points for too many stories. Know what your points are, enforce them and stop. Timing is important.
Set your pace, speak naturally, speak easily, imagine yourself having a conversation with a friend, Memorise your points, this will help train you memory. If folks are listening to learn the you may need to slow down. if folks are listening out of general interest then you can use a quicker pace.
To make a good presentation, practice reading aloud. yes when you read don't read it with your mind read it aloud. this allows you to pronounce every syllable distinctly and develop a natural conversational pace and volume. this then helps us to hear outlives as we would hear others.
If your pitch is high start off low. a naturally high pitched voice tends to get higher as one progresses in the sentence. practice the pitch and pace and you will be more interesting to the hearer and have more confidence as a public speaker.
